On April 30, 2019, Tarena announced that it had terminated its Annual Report for Fiscal Year 2018 due to an ongoing “review of certain issues identified during its audit of the Registrant’s financial statements for the year ended December 31, 2018, including questions related to the revenue recognition of the registrant. ”

As a result of this news, the price of Tarena’s American Depositary Shares (“ADSs”) fell 1.2% to close at $ 5.02 per ADS on May 1, 2019, hurting investors.

On May 17, 2019, the company announced that Tarena had been notified that it was not complying with NASDAQ listing rules because the 2018 annual report was not filed on time.

As a result of this news, Tarena’s ADS fell 4.8% to close at $ 3.73 per ADS on May 20, 2019, causing harm to investors.

On July 24, 2019, Tarena announced that it anticipates that fiscal year 2017 and earlier periods “may need to be adjusted and should not be relied upon until the independent audit committee’s review is complete”.

On the back of this news, Tarena’s ADS fell 4.7% and closed at $ 1.63 per ADS on July 25, 2019, causing harm to investors.

Finally, on November 1, 2019, Tarena announced the results of its investigation, including a list of revenue inaccuracies for fiscal years 2014 through 2018, spending inaccuracies and irregularities, and undisclosed transactions with related parties. Tarena further announced that it “expects the total amount of false sales reported between fiscal years 2014 to 2018 to be less than RMB 900 million, which is approximately 11.5% of the total sales previously reported by the company for that period.” .

On the back of this news, Tarena’s ADSs fell 9.4% and opened at $ 0.76 on November 4, 2019, the next trading day, adding further damage to investors.

The lawsuit filed alleges that during the class action period, defendants made materially false and / or misleading statements and failed to disclose material adverse facts about the company’s business, operations and prospects. In particular, Defendants have failed to disclose to investors that: (1) certain employees interfered with external audits of Tarena’s financial statements for certain periods of time; (2) Tarena suffered from revenue and expenditure inaccuracies; (3) Tarena has conducted business transactions with organizations owned, invested by, or controlled by Tarena employees or their family members, which in some cases have not been properly disclosed by Tarena; (4) Due to the foregoing, Tarena’s financial statements from 2014 to the end of the class action period were inaccurate; and (5) as a result, Defendants’ statements about its business, operations and prospects were materially false and misleading and / or were inadequate at all relevant times.
